New type of surgery can help amputees better control their residual muscles

New type of surgery can help amputees better control their residual muscles MIT researchers have invented a new type of amputation surgery that can help amputees to better control their residual muscles and sense where their phantom limb is in space. This restored sense of proprioception should translate to better control of prosthetic limbs, as well as a reduction of limb pain, the researchers say. In most amputations, muscle pairs that control the affected joints, such as elbows or ankles, are severed. However, the MIT team has found that reconnecting these muscle pairs, allowing them to retain their normal push-pull relationship, offers people much better sensory feedback.
